ip classles
生活随笔
收集整理的這篇文章主要介紹了
ip classles
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
Cisco ip classless總結(jié)關(guān)于ip classless問題,給個簡單的例子,假設(shè)show ip route時在路由表中有以下輸出C 10.1.1.0/24 s0/0 C 10.1.2.0/24 s0/1 S? ? 10.1.3.0/24 s0/0 S 0.0.0.0/0? ?? ?s0/1 問路由器收到IP包,目的地址10.1.4.1,路由器該如何轉(zhuǎn)發(fā)? 問路由器收到IP包,目的地址20.1.4.1,路由器該如何轉(zhuǎn)發(fā)? 根據(jù)常識大家都會說走默認(rèn)路由?;卮鹫_,但是這只是在ip classless命令生效的時候。如 果去除這條命令,結(jié)果就是去 20.1.4.1走默認(rèn)路由,去10.1.4.1路由器則丟棄! 為什么這樣,在沒有ip classless命令生效的時候,cisco 路由器找路由記錄首先看目的地址? ?? ?是哪個大的網(wǎng)絡(luò)號,如現(xiàn)在10.1.4.1的大網(wǎng)絡(luò)號是10.0.0.0,因為它是A類地址,然后在路由表中找這個大網(wǎng)絡(luò)號或其子網(wǎng)的相關(guān)的記錄,如果 能找到對應(yīng)記錄則轉(zhuǎn)發(fā),如果找不到則丟棄。為什么不走默認(rèn)路由?因為現(xiàn)在路由器認(rèn)為它知道10.0.0.0這個A類地址上的所有子網(wǎng),例子中只有3個 10.1.1.0/24, 10.1.2.0/24 , 10.1.3.02/24,數(shù)據(jù)包要去的10.1.4.0/24這個子網(wǎng)并不存在,所以將數(shù)據(jù)包丟掉。 去20.1.4.1則不同,因為路由表中沒有20.0.0.0這個大網(wǎng)絡(luò)號的相關(guān)路由記錄,所以立刻走默認(rèn)路由。 總結(jié):ip classless命令其實是影響的路由表查找的方法,最直接的效果就是對默認(rèn)路由的使用。有了ip classless命令,則路由器查找路由表使用的是最長匹配原則,而不首先考慮目的地址是哪個類的 總結(jié): 加一條ip classless命令,那么路由器成為無類路由環(huán)境,當(dāng)目的數(shù)據(jù)包到達時,不進行有類匹配,而是進行無類匹配,即進行最長匹配原則;當(dāng)用最長匹配時不在路由表內(nèi),那么路由器將把它交給默認(rèn)路由,通過默認(rèn)路由,把數(shù)據(jù)包送出。 使用有類路有,當(dāng)一個路由器收到一個數(shù)據(jù)包,而它的目的地址在路由表中不存在的話,它就會丟棄這個數(shù)據(jù)包。如果你使用了缺省路由,就必須使用ip classless命令,因為遠端子網(wǎng)并不存在于你的路由表\\中。 |
轉(zhuǎn)載于:https://blog.51cto.com/1431167/364067
總結(jié)
以上是生活随笔為你收集整理的ip classles的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 山东莱芜职业技术学院有多少人
- 下一篇: Spring Hibernate使用Tr